BATH — Frohmiller Construction/ Midcoast Marble picked up a doubleheader win in recent Bath Men’s softball play.
Frohmiller Construction/ Midcoast Marble defeated Ravens Roost, 13-8.
Pitcher Nick Green had a standout game at the plate and on the mound, keeping Ravens under 10 runs with two strikeouts and helping himself with a bases-clearing triple. Carl Nygaard and Ryan Chaney contributed two home runs each.
In game two, Frohmiller Construction/Midcoast Marble walked away with a 16-14 victory.
Mike Dunning went 3-for-3 and with a two-run shot to give his team a five-run lead in the seventh. Brandon Shorey and Drew Colby both went 3-for-4 with a combined five runs.
